The addax, a desert-dwelling antelope, obtains energy primarily through herbivory, feeding on a variety of vegetation such as grasses, shrubs, and leaves. Adapted to arid environments, it is capable of extracting moisture from its food, which helps it survive in areas with limited water sources. By grazing on nutrient-rich plants, the addax efficiently converts plant material into energy, enabling it to thrive in harsh conditions.
